Had a new bronze unit installed less than two years ago and the temperature is now reading 130°. Worked perfyuntil about a month ago, then suddenly almost 50 degrees high. Anyone else have a similar issue?

Thanks
 
What's it hooked up to?
 
What's it hooked up to?

N2K network with a bunch of Maretron displays all over the boat. 5 DSM150’s, 2 DSM250’s and a TSM800C.
 
Did you upgrade the firmware on anything in the system
 
Check the power and grounding.
 
Check the power and grounding.

Thanks Scott - there are 3 12V power sources and three grounds for the entire N2K nework(s). I don’t think any of those are suspect since all of the other bells and whistles are working perfectly , but will double check.
 
Called Airmar, its always such a nice surprise when a knowledgeable person answers the phone on the first try. I'm just under warranty, and fortunately it is a removable unit with the temporary plug tie wrapped on the bulkhead.

I'd feel better if I knew the cause, but according to Airmar it is likely a rare thermistor failure.
